site stats

Setstate array push

Web6 Sep 2024 · You can make a new variable and push to the variable then set the state after the map is complete. var tempArray = [] … Web20 Aug 2024 · React may batch updates, and therefore the correct approach is to provide setState with a function that performs the update. For the React update addon, the …

javascript - TypeScript Error - Type

Web15 Nov 2024 · I have fixed it buy reseting list with empty array but you can just pop/shift functions from an array to reduce pressure on garbage collection. At this point we can write code like this: setState(newState) myCallbacksList.current.push(myCallback).. setState(newState2) myCallbacksList.current.push(myCallback2) Web8 Nov 2024 · how to add array data on state react this.setState({ myArray: [...this.state.myArray, 'new value'] }) //simple value this.setState({ myArray... Level up your programming skills with exercises across 52 languages, and insightful discussion with our dedicated team of welcoming mentors. toys bobble head suit https://cascaderimbengals.com

React/ReactJS: Update an Array State - ScriptVerse

WebBelow example presents two functions: handleAddItem that uses spread operator ( ...) to create a copy of array in the state, adds an item to it and then with setState () method updates the state value. handleRemoveItem that uses filter () method to remove item with the last index from the array. Runnable example: xxxxxxxxxx 1 Web25 Jul 2024 · It won’t trigger a render if you just push to the the array. It also won’t trigger a render if you mutate that array and then set it as the new state, since the two states refer to the same object. The correct thing to do is always make … Web9 Oct 2024 · const {useState, useCallback} = React; function Example () { const [theArray, setTheArray] = useState ( []); const addEntryClick = () => { setTheArray ( [...theArray, `Entry … toys bogota

How to push an Element into a state Array in React bobbyhadz

Category:what is the correct way to push and pop an element to an array ... - reddit

Tags:Setstate array push

Setstate array push

Which method should we use in setState, push or concat? 【JS】

Web27 Feb 2024 · You can’t use methods like .push() to directly mutate the state object. Use setState() Method in React. React components internally use the setState() method to … Web17 May 2024 · One way would be to exchange places for the concat method from before (e.g. const list = [state.value].concat (state.list); ). Another way of doing it would be using …

Setstate array push

Did you know?

Web7 Oct 2024 · Now, browser turns into following view: If you don’t see it, just choose Project Overview. Click on Web App, you will see: Set the nickname and choose Register App for next step. Copy the script for later use. Choose Database in the left (list of Firebase features) -> Realtime Database -> Create Database. WebInstead of inserting the item itself maybe you can hold an object for each item in your array with item's unique id. That object also could hold quantity. Then you can generate card info via this unique id. cart: [ { id: uniqeId, quantiy: 1 }, { id: uniqeId, quantiy: 6 }, ] After adding an item to card, you can go and just alter the related ...

Web2 Feb 2024 · push mutates the state directly, and although you’re calling setState immediately afterward, you risk unexpected behavior; the most likely is that the component simply won’t re-render, thinking the state hasn’t changed. Better to keep it non-mutating: var newCard = [...this.state.card, this.props.tvSeries [i]]; jenovs March 5, 2024, 2:48am #8 Web27 Feb 2024 · add data in array in react js push state in array reac push in array state react push js array react js how to add object to array in react state push to usestate how to push into state in react add value to array in react js add values in array in react js add new array at the back of react state add object in array state react push values to state array class …

Web如何向具有子项的菜单元素添加箭头?. 我正在尝试在我的菜单中每个具有子项的项目旁边添加一个FontAwesome箭头 (即,我想指示您可以单击该元素以在该类别中显示更多数据)。. 菜单是用来自API的json数据填充的,因为它是如此多的嵌套对象,所以我决定使用递 ... WebThe npm package react-native-calendar-picker receives a total of 11,104 downloads a week. As such, we scored react-native-calendar-picker popularity level to be Recognized. Based on project statistics from the GitHub repository for the npm package react-native-calendar-picker, we found that it has been starred 710 times.

Web1 Nov 2024 · To download Axios, navigate to your root project directory where your package.json file is located, and run the command: npm install --save axios. Now you have Axios installed inside of your React project and can start using it! In the code below, you will see the basic shell of a SolarSystem component.

Web16 Aug 2024 · Push Data Into State Array in React Many JavaScript developers use the .push () method to add items to the end of the array. This works fine in plain JavaScript, but if the array is a state variable (or a property of a state object), using the .push () method can have unexpected results. toys bodytoys board gamesWeb18 Nov 2024 · this.setState(prevState => ({ data: { ...prevState.data, features: [] // Or whatever you need your new array to be } })); So say you wanted to add another element … toys bollWeb24 May 2016 · You should not be operating the state at all. At least, not directly. If you want to update your array, you'll want to do something like this. var newStateArray = this.state.myArray.slice(); newStateArray.push('new value'); this.setState(myArray: … toys bolognaWebThe way you wrote removeSquare won't work because pop() mutates the array and returns the element that was removed (not the updated array as you would want). So you want to use squares.slice(0, -1) instead.. And someone already mentioned, you should use the function that accepts previous value, like this: const adSquare = setSquare(previousValue … toys bologna orariWebSaya ingin menambahkan elemen ke akhir a state array, apakah ini cara yang benar untuk melakukannya? this. state. arrayvar. push (newelement); this. setState ({arrayvar: this. state. arrayvar}); Saya khawatir bahwa memodifikasi array di tempat pushdapat menyebabkan masalah - apakah aman? Alternatif membuat salinan array, dan setStateitu tampak ... toys booda petWebTo update the state in an array of objects when the change occurs ( onChange ). We will create an array and store it inside the useState hook. Then, we will make a function updateState that will handle our onChange property. Let’s see it in action. Creating an array with useState () toys boots